Apple unveils iPad Air
Apple Inc. on
Tuesday unveiled a Retina iPad Mini and the iPad Air, a thinner, faster
full-size iPad that Apple executives said was innovative enough to
"deserve a new name." The iPad Air weighs 1 pound and runs on Apple's
new A7 chip, said Phil Schiller, senior vice president of worldwide marketing
at Apple. It will also have an updated camera. It will come in silver, white,
space gray and black and will start at $499. With cellular capabilities, it
will run $629. Apple also
announced it will add a Retina display faster chips to its iPad Mini. Apple fans are still anticipating news
of a fifth-generation iPad and second-generation iPad Mini with Retina display
before the product event ends.
